Our Geoscience team:
Venterra’s Geoscience team is made up of market-leading experts from Ordtek, GDG, and Partrac. We offer unparalleled site characterisation, geoscience management, sediment processes, UXO management, and GIS and data services, tailored to meet the comprehensive needs of our clients.
Role Description:
We are looking for an experienced Senior Operations Geophysicist to join our dynamic team within Venterra’s Geoscience service line. This key role focuses on supporting successful delivery of high-quality geophysical survey products and data interpretation for offshore wind farm projects at all stages of development. You will ensure that project deliverables meet quality standards while adhering to budget, timeline, and resource guidelines.
The role will provide opportunities to explore and appraise the application of pioneering technologies to address project needs and develop and contribute to best practices and innovation.
Primarily based in one of our Geoscience member company offices in Hethel (Norwich), Newcastle or Hamburg, we offer hybrid working, with employees spending three days per week in the office, providing flexibility and promoting work-life balance.
Key Responsibilities:
* Provide clear leadership and task coordination within the team, assigning responsibilities that play to individual strengths and competencies.
* Provide input to survey and site investigation strategies, aligning survey methodologies with site conditions and geohazard risks.
* Critically appraise existing geophysical datasets and assess usability against project requirements, provide commentary on limitations and factors which may impact future data acquisition.
* Design and review scopes of work and technical specifications for offshore surveys.
* Critically evaluate tender documents and support clarifications on behalf of clients.
* Contribute to the review of survey contractors project execution plan (PEP and supporting documents) before on-site activities commence.
* Attend site/vessel and project kick-off meetings where required.
* Be active in managing survey contractors and client representatives to ensure the delivery of high-quality data from offshore survey campaigns.
* Perform Quality Assurance and support Interpretation of geophysical datasets (multibeam echosounder, side scan sonar, magnetometer/gradiometer, sub-bottom profiler and multi-channel seismic) as part of a wider team, integrate with existing data and site knowledge and identify seabed and subsurface hazards.
* Process/reprocess geophysical data sets as required using industry standard software packages provide deliverables to produce charts and input to reports.
* Quality check contractors’ data, interpretation and reporting deliverables and provide review commentary and actions for improvement.
* Communicate the results of any survey in a clear fashion to the team, clients, senior managers, or partners, including those with a limited understanding of geoscience. This includes presenting findings at meetings and presentations.
* Keep abreast of new and emerging technologies and methodologies.
* Provide evaluation commentary on data collection techniques and support improvements in existing techniques in data acquisition and processing.
* Provide support, technical advice, and guidance to project teams, client and other project stakeholders.
* Oversee the production of and contribute to technical reporting, leading teams to deliver thorough and comprehensive project documentation.
